Component Inspection INFOID:0000000010702980 1. CHECK EOP SENSOR 1. Turn ignition switch OFF. 2. Disconnect EOP sensor harness connector. 3. Check resistance between EOP sensor connector terminals. Is the inspection result normal? YES >> INSPECTION END + − Continuity ECM Connector Terminal F15 11 Ground Existed E57 123 125 128 + − Continuity EOP sensor ECM Connector Terminal Connector Terminal F117 2 F15 29 Existed EOP sensor Resistance + − Terminal 1 2 4 - 10 k Ω 3 2 - 8 k Ω 2 1 4 - 10 k Ω 3 1 - 3 k Ω 3 1 2 - 8 k Ω 2 1 - 3 k Ω |
